Technical identity card

Full specifications BMW 550e xDrive Touring

Manufacturer data. Consumption and range estimated from the WLTP cycle; performance simulated by the Caralogy physics engine.

Powertrain

Architecture6 cyl.
Displacement2,998 cm³
Puissance électrique197 hp
Combined power489 hp
Couple700 Nm
GearboxConvertisseur de couple 8 rapports Automatique
TransmissionIntegrale (AWD)

Battery and charging

Battery capacity19 kWh
Range WLTP82 km
Charge AC max11 kW
Conso élec WLTP23.2 kWh/100km
Petrol cons. WLTP1.1 L/100km
Conso thermique8.5 L/100km
Tank60 L
EV range motorway66 km
Total range motorway788 km

Performance

0 → 100 km/h4,4 s
VMax250 km/h

Dimensions and environment

Length5,060 mm
Wheelbase2,995 mm
Width1,900 mm
Height1,515 mm
Boot570 L
Kerb weight2,210 kg
Cd0.26
CO₂ WLTP25 g/km

Caralogy Verdict
Suitable for

Home-to-office commute up to 60 km in pure electric. Overnight charging is sufficient.

Less suitable for

Regular long motorway trips. Once the 82 km EV range is used up, the car runs on pure combustion at 8.5 L/100 - high for a PHEV in this class. On trips >300 km weekly, a BEV or HEV would be more efficient.

Alternatives to consider

If the priority is Electric WLTP range, the Audi A6 Sedan e-hybrid quattro S tronic 270 kW (1st with 101 km) takes the lead. If the priority is Combined range, the Mercedes AMG E 53 HYBRID 4MATIC+ Limousine (1st with 1184 km) takes the lead.
